A first-generation Vapid SUV is due to appear in Grand Theft Auto VI, having debuted with a red interior in the September 2022 leaks. In the first trailer it lies overturned on a busy Leonida highway and later appears behind a PMP 700 beside a Bravado pickup, and it is also shown close up in two official screenshots.
Trailer and screenshot locations
At 1:03 of the first Grand Theft Auto VI trailer, the Vapid SUV is upside down on a heavily travelled highway in Leonida. A second trailer glimpse at 1:07 shows its side behind a PMP 700 and next to a Bravado pickup; the pillar layout corresponds with the overturned vehicle.
Official screenshots provide the clearest identified views. One shows a redneck leaning against the front end, where the Vapid emblem is visible. Another depicts the truck’s rear outside Delights.
Design inspiration and classification
Vapid is the in-game manufacturer, while the vehicle is assigned to the lighttruck class and described as a Light Truck. Its styling appears to combine several late-1990s truck and SUV influences rather than reproduce one model unchanged.
The rear lamps and rear-end treatment resemble 1998–2001 Ford Explorer XLT and XL versions from the Explorer’s second generation. Its headlamp and grille treatment draw on the second-generation Ford Ranger, with further cues from the first-generation Ford Expedition. Footage from the 2022 leaks also suggests that the front bumper takes after the fifth-generation Toyota Hilux and second-generation Toyota 4Runner.
